The 45 RPM-7" record was the most popular form of a vinyl single. The RCA Victor Company introduced this new concept in March 1949 as a replacement for the 78 RPM record . The first generation of 45 rpm records were monaural and included songs on both sides and it was doing the 1960's that stereo recordings replaced the monaural sounds.
